A new assay for aminopeptidase P was established by coupling with proline iminopeptidase using Gly-Pro-chromogen (e.g. Gly-Pro-β-naphthylamide, Gly-Pro-p-nitroanilide, or .Gly-Pro-4-methyl coumarin amide) as the substrate. With each substrate, a linear relationship was established between the enzyme amounts and color development or fluorescence due to the chromogen released. This assay method did not suffer from interference by materials in culture broth. By using this assay method, aminopeptidase P was partially purified from Escherichia coli HB101 by chromatographies on DEAE-Sephadex and high performance liquid chromatography (HPLC). On the chromatogram with a DEAE-Sephadex column, two peaks of aminopeptidase P were observed and were named APP-I and APP-II. APP-I was further purified by HPLC using DEAE-5PW and Phenyl-5PW columns. Optimum pHs of APP-I and APP-II were 8.0 and 9.0, respectively. In contrast to APP-I which was stable around pH 10, APP-II was stable at pH 8 to 9. After incubation for 30 min at pH 8.0, fifty percent of the remaining activity of APP-I and APP-II were observed at 60°C and 50°C. APP-I and APP-II were activated 3-fold by the addition of 5 and 30 μm Mn2+. They were inhibited by EDTA, and reactivated by adding Mn2 +. The molecular weights of APP-I and APP-II were 350,000 and 210,000, respectively. Each enzymes released the amino terminal amino acid when proline is at the penultimate position. The velocity of hydrolysis by the enzymes was not significantly different for most X-Pro bonds (X = amino acid) of peptides except for Pro-Pro bond. APP-II hydrolyzed penta-(Pro-Pro-Gly) at a much higher rate than APP-I, suggesting the aminopeptidase P reported by Yaron and Mlynar (BBRC, 32, 658 (1968)) to be APP-II. 相似文献

Some sediment sequences were known in the Elbe-Saale region. They enable a subdivision of the Saale complex, that is from Neumark Nord (Geisel valley), from Weimar-Ehringsdorf and Bad Kösen-Lengefeld (Saale valley). According to it, there are two interglacials between the Saalian groundmoraine (s.str.) and the Eemian. They are characterized by a strong subcontinental climatic influence, which could not be observed in the other interglacials of the Elbe-Saale region. The interglacials are connected with find horizons from the Middle Palaeolithic. They are concisely described here with their inventories. 相似文献

Histological subtypes of lymphomas are important because FDG uptake is much greater in aggressive than in indolent lymphomas and this, results in lower sensitivity of PET for the staging of indolent lymphomas. Staging is especially useful when treatment is changed according to staging. Staging with imaging methods has traditionally been performed using a CT scanner and has been based on the detection of nodal enlargement, an increased number of small nodes and in the presence of extranodal masses. However, CT is limited by its poor sensitivity in the detection of extranodal sites of involvement, in the identification of tumour involvement of normal size lymph nodes and in the differentiation between malignant and inflammatory enlarged lymph nodes. The uptake of FDG detected with PET images reflects metabolic activity rather than the size of the tissue masses, localizing tumoral activity in enlarged and in normal size lymph nodes. In the literature review that compares PET with CT, PET usually indicates more lesions than CT would and PET improves sensitivity without losing specificity. However, the majority of studies report that PET, improves the staging in a relatively limited number of patients (10-20%) and may change treatment in less than 10% of patients. Diagnostic accuracy of PET may improve with the use of hybrid PET/CT systems that combine metabolic and morphological imaging, in the same scanner and without moving the patient. This is a promising technique that will overcome the limitations of both modalities and may enhance diagnostic accuracy in lymphoma patients. This hybrid equipment allows the use of PET/CT with contrast-enhanced full dose CT (a diagnostic CT) instead of carrying out PET and CT on different days. 相似文献

The excavation of L’Essart (Poitiers) makes it possible for the first time in the west of France to understand a very particular habitat, along a river and very much marked by the firing activities. The substrate of the site assigns the shape of a dome surrounded to the east by the Clain River, to the west by a channel. Abundant vestiges allotted to the recent Neolithic lay in the lower half of a layer of brown silts. Immediately subjacent, a level of ten centimetres, located at the top of orange silts, contained burnt stones structures: 39 hearths (circular area posed flat approximately one meter of diameter) and 14 dismantled hearths. It is dated from the final Mesolithic by the extremely abundant lithic material discovered in the layer. Lithic industry is carried out in a preferential way on bajocians flints available on the slope (62%) and oxfordians flints (8%) known to approximately two kilometres. The principal characters of this industry are a frontal exploitation of core, a production of prismatic blades, many notches of Montbani type on the blades, asymmetrical trapezoids with concave truncations (of which Trapezoids of Payré), right-angled trapezoids with concave truncations, scalene triangles with flat retouches and arrows of Montclus. The analogies with Retzian (Vendée and Loire-Atlantique) are certainly numerous, but it is rather about a relationship in a vaster unit that remains to define. The non anecdotic presence of the arrows of Montclus involves the discussion on the question of the zones of contacts between Neolithic and Mesolithic of the second half of the VIth millenium BC. 相似文献

Carcinine biosynthesis was induced in vitro from its two components, beta-alanine and histamine. The reaction was catalyzed by muscle, heart, and CNS extracts from Carcinus maenas. The specific activity of the enzyme, carcinine synthetase, was 15 times higher in CNS than in other organs. Only CNS extracts induced biosynthesis of carcinine from histidine, and only in the presence of pyridoxal-5'-phosphate. Hence the seat of carcinine biosynthesis seems to be the CNS. It is highly probable that in the CNS, histidine is transformed into histamine, which is then catabolized into carcinine. The latter would then be transported and accumulated in the cardiac tissue. Thus histamine--the metabolism of which takes place totally within the CNS--would be implicated as a participant in the neuronal activity of Carcinus maenas. Carcinine synthetase is a soluble enzyme that requires the presence of ATP, beta-alanine, and histamine. Mg2+ and dithiothreitol are also essential for activity. Optimum pH is approximately 7.6. Carcinine synthetase differs from carnosine synthetase and gamma-glutamylhistamine synthetase in that it does not catalyze synthesis of beta-alanylhistidine or gamma-glutamylhistamine. 相似文献

The two main tyrosine kinases (TK) in the brain are p60Src and p59Fyn, expressed as specific isoforms (p60SrcNI, p60SrcNI + NII and p59fynB). They play a pivotal role in some major processes such as neuronal growth and myelinisation. Another member of this TK family was then reported in brain, the p56lck. Its name Lck (lymphocyte cell kinase) indicates its cellular specificity observed initially, so its presence in the brain was intriguing. But no further studies were performed to understand its role in brain until recent clinical studies on Alzheimer patients’ brains. One study reveals a decreased p56lck level in the brains of these patients while another study shows an association between one peculiar SNP (single nucleotide polymorphism) of the lck gene and some cases of the disease. These new data prompt us to reinvestigate the original biochemical data and to confront them with the present knowledge. This analysis suggests some hypothesis concerning both the Lck protein expressed in the brain (rather an isoform than the lymphocyte protein itself) and its role (to maintain the neuronal survival presumably by protecting them from inflammation, the main pathway that leads to neuron degeneracy). 相似文献

This article aims at drawing up balance sheet of remains of fire use by the first Neanderthals of Northern France, during the second part of the Saalian (MIS 8 to 6). This overview reminds us the rarity of fire testimonies during Early Middle Palaeolithic (300–130 ky BP) on the scale of North-Western Europe. For Northern France, only the sites of Biache-Saint-Vaast and Therdonne present remains of combustion. At Biache-Saint-Vaast, it is not less than six levels, which present clues of combustion: burnt flint and faunal remains and sometimes charcoals. At Therdonne, besides burnt numerous flint and some rare faunal remains were brought to light during the excavation of level N3 several rich zones in organic residues and micro-charcoals. All the datas collected concerning the clues of combustion at Biache-Saint-Vaast and Therdonne is compiled, analyzed and interpreted. This approach permits to establish the fire use or its absence in saalian occupations of Neanderthals of Northern France and to discuss modalities of its use, particularly at Therdonne. To conclude, fire status and its implications in first Neanderthals occupations are briefly discussed. 相似文献

Influence of light intensity and wavelength on the yield of free radicals in seeds of tomato and carrot.
Seeds of tomato ( Lycopersicum esculentum L. cv. Gribovsky-1180) and carrot ( Daucus carota L. cv. Santanet) were irradiated by continuous light of different wavelengths (white, blue, green, red, far-red and He-Ne laser) and different power density. Free radical output was measured using Electron Spin Resonance spectra (ESR). The dependence of the content of free radicals (FR) on the light power density was established. The yield of FR in the seeds irradiated with monochromatic light of the same power density was inversely proportional to the wavelength. The ESR spectra showed maximum absolute number of FR for white light. Successive irradiations gave cumulative effects on the output of free radicals in both directions: increase by the action of white light and decrease by the action of red and far-red light. The contact of irradiated seeds with steam decreased the amount of FR. 相似文献

Role of ethylene in both the synthesis of capsidiol and the susceptibility to Phytophthora capsici of pepper treated with an elicitor With inoculated plants, there is a strong increase of ethylene, specially with Phyo 636. But, with plants inoculated and treated with G5 15 the quantities of ethylene are less important than with those ones inoculated and untreated with G5 15. After contamination (and only in this case), there is capsidiol synthesis as well wit h treated plants as with untreated ones, and the quantities are not significantly different. Generally, the level of induced resistance is higher wit h Phyo 636 (genetically resistant) than with Yolo Wonder (genetically susceptible). The adjunction of ethylene precursor (ACC) to G5 15 elicitor increases induced resistance with Yolo Wonder but decreases with Phyo 636: the inverse effect is observed when using ethylene inhibitor (AVG). It is suggested that, in the interaction Pepper—Phytophthora capsia, neither ethylene production nor capsidiol synthesis can be considered as biochemical tracers of induced resistance. 相似文献
